Handover for the Driftmark profile-store sharding work, relevant to plugin authors because shard routing changes the lookup API. Shards are keyed by a stable hash of the profile handle; plugins must use resolveShard() rather than hardcoding hosts. Migration of the Tellwood region is half done—shards 0 through 7 moved, 8 through 15 pending. Rebalancing scripts live in the ops repo under driftmark/shardtool. To run them you'll need access to the migration vault, which unlocks with the passphrase directly below.

unlock words, hahip-baduf: holwyn-istath-julvan

## Deploying SproutTimer

Welcome aboard! SproutTimer is our plant-watering scheduler and it deploys from a single branch — no release trains, no drama. Run the build script, let the Greenrow pipeline do its checks, and promote when it's green. The scheduler daemon reads its settings at boot, so restart it after any change. A fresh deploy comes up with the following configuration.

settings of tagef-bawif:
DRUIX_HOST=druix.zemvarlabs.internal
DRUIX_PORT=8000

## Shard migration: Plumeline profile store

Before moving any shard, verify the dual-write flag is enabled and the Corvid replication lag gauge reads under five seconds. Drain one shard at a time; never parallelize across the Westhollow replicas. If checksums diverge, halt and page storage leads immediately. Record the migration against the build token below.

build token for kagaf-hahof: htk14_9d3d4d26d7d8de

Subject: Proctorline queue — first on-call shift

Welcome aboard. The Proctorline exam-proctoring queue pages when session reviews back up past 30 minutes. Most incidents are a stuck worker; restart it and confirm the backlog drains. Do not purge the queue — exams in flight would lose review records. Escalate to Marek if drain stalls. The full runbook and dashboards are on the page below.

wiki page, hahif-hahif: https://argocd.kelvisys.corp/browse/board/settings/pages/1442e0b1065d83f1

## Ownership

The Ledgerpane audit-log viewer is owned by the Trust Tooling squad. All changes to query filters, retention display, or export paths require squad review. No direct pushes to main; redaction logic changes need a second approver. Performance regressions over 200ms on the timeline view block merge. Direct review requests and escalations to the owner named below.

account owner for tahof-fajef: Holax Druir Fraiel Wenir